Learn C++ without a C background - this book shows programmers how. In "C++ From the Ground Up", internationally renowned author Herbert Schildt applies his proven teaching expertise to the basic constructs of the C++ language. Programmers with no prior knowledge of C will quickly gain understanding of the power and uses of C++, the language of choice for Windows developers. Millions of readers have trusted Herbert Schildt to teach them C and C++. This book continues that tradition by providing solid material in a straightforward format.
